Full Plot Summary

spoilers

The Straw Hats arrive at a volcanic island that does not appear on the New World Log Pose. Luffy in his enthusiasm, votes to go to the island, though most of his crew are reluctant to go with him. The crew than receives a distress call from someone on the island who is being attacked by a samurai. They then draw sticks on who will go with Luffy, and who will stay on the ship, with Zoro, Robin, and Usopp coming with Luffy. With the help of Nami's clouds, the scouting group arrives at the main entrance which Zoro cuts down with ease. The group wanders the area seeing the whole place on fire, wondering what happened to the island. Their exploration is suddenly cut short when they encounter a dragon looking hungrily at them. At Raijin Island, Smoker and Tashigi intercept the distress call that Luffy picked up and order the G-5 Marines to set a course for Punk Hazard.
